Reading Applet variable to javascript but getting some [native code] error?
Hello All,
I am trying to get the value of an applet variable into a javascript variable.
The variable in applet is: Public String list;
I am accepting it in javascript as: var val = document.content.list; where content is the applet name or ID
When I do: alert(val); , I get an alert box with "Hi" on it. Which is as expected.
However when I try to do: alert(val.length); , i get an alert box with "function length { [native code] }" in it.
I have seen such a thing for the first time in my life, I am quite new to the world of coding.
Can anyone tell me how can I solve this problem, because further I need to pass this javascript variable val to a server side script using Xmlhttp method.
Presently when I am passing the variable, it doesn't get saved on the server which I intend to do after passing the variable.
Any Suggestions??mailsforabhinav wrote:
However when I try to do: alert(val.length); , i get an alert box with "function length { [native code] }" in it.That's because the returned String is still a Java string so you have to use val.length() to get the length!
If really want to convert the Java string to Javascript String then do
var val = document.content.list + "";
alert(val.length);Bye. -
EXCEPTION_ACCESS_VIOLATION exception has been detected in native code outs
Here is my error :
# An EXCEPTION_ACCESS_VIOLATION exception has been detected in native code outside the VM.
# Program counter=0x502032cf
Problem I have though is the app will run fine on 1 PC, but the same installation on another causes this. OS == NT ( i don't know too much about NT)
Not really sure what to do about this one, really grateful for any advice.
ThxIt most windows JNI code an ACCESS_VIOLATION indicates a memory problem: buffer overwrite, underwrite, dereference a null pointer, etc.
I would suggest going through the JNI code and put in more error checking: return values from methods, check for non-null input params, etc. -
